jBASE是一种多值数据库管理系统,它使用了一种称为"jEDI"的技术来确定文件所在的位置。jEDI是jBASE的文件系统,它通过使用逻辑文件名和文件路径来确定文件的位置。
在jBASE中,文件可以通过逻辑文件名进行访问,而不需要指定完整的文件路径。逻辑文件名是一个用户定义的名称,用于标识文件。文件路径是指文件在文件系统中的实际位置。
jBASE使用一个称为"jRFS"(jBASE Remote File System)的组件来管理文件的位置。jRFS是一个分布式文件系统,它可以将文件存储在不同的物理位置上,包括本地磁盘、网络共享文件系统或其他远程服务器上。
当应用程序需要访问一个文件时,jBASE会根据逻辑文件名查找文件的位置。它首先检查本地文件系统,如果找不到,则会查询jRFS来查找文件的位置。jRFS会根据文件的逻辑文件名和文件路径来确定文件的位置,并将文件传输到应用程序所在的服务器上进行访问。
jBASE还提供了一些命令和工具来管理文件的位置。例如,可以使用"CREATE-FILE"命令来创建一个新的文件,并指定文件的逻辑文件名和文件路径。可以使用"LIST-FILE"命令来列出文件的位置信息。
总之,jBASE使用逻辑文件名和文件路径来确定文件的位置,并通过jRFS来管理文件的存储和访问。这种设计使得文件的位置可以灵活地配置和管理,同时提供了高可用性和可扩展性。对于jBASE用户来说,他们只需要知道逻辑文件名即可访问文件,而不需要关心文件的具体位置。
领取专属 10元无门槛券
手把手带您无忧上云